Asbestos roof removal regulations and guidelines are crucial to ensuring the safety of each staff and the common public. Asbestos, once a well-liked development material because of its heat resistance and durability, is now recognized for its serious health risks. Exposure to asbestos fibers can lead to diseases similar to asbestosis, lung cancer, and mesothelioma. Given the hazardous nature of asbestos, it's essential to comply with stringent regulations and guidelines when removing it from buildings.


National and native regulations govern the removal and disposal of asbestos. The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) supplies a framework to handle asbestos safely during various levels of removal. Understanding these regulations is essential for householders, contractors, and companies planning any renovation or demolition work involving asbestos. Adherence to these guidelines not only helps in reducing health risks but additionally avoids potential legal repercussions.

Local regulations might vary considerably, adding another layer of complexity when coping with asbestos. It is crucial for people and firms to familiarize themselves with state and local guidelines along with federal regulations. These often embody particular coaching requirements for workers, notification processes, and waste disposal protocols.


It is crucial to interact licensed professionals for asbestos roof removal. These consultants have the required coaching and gear to handle asbestos safely. In many jurisdictions, the removal of asbestos requires a licensed contractor. It just isn't merely a matter of comfort; it is a authorized obligation in most areas the place asbestos has been recognized.

The preliminary step in asbestos removal is conducting a thorough inspection. This contains figuring out the location and kind of asbestos-containing materials (Roof Removal, Disposal & Replacement). A complete evaluation permits for a tailor-made removal plan that aligns with relevant regulations. It’s essential to document all findings and develop a strategy that adheres to safety protocols.


Once a plan is in place, notification of the removal project to the related authorities is often required. This contains submitting the primary points of the project, which may include timelines and strategies of removal. Proper notification isn't just a formality but a crucial step in ensuring health and environmental security.

Personal protecting gear (PPE) is a crucial element of the removal course of. Workers involved in asbestos roof removal must put on applicable gear to attenuate exposure to asbestos fibers. This usually includes respirators, gloves, and specialized clothing designed to prevent the inhalation of harmful particles. Ensuring that each one staff are adequately protected reduces the chance of health points considerably.


Containment is one other essential aspect of the asbestos removal course of. The space must be barricaded, and procedures have to be in place to prevent any launch of asbestos fibers into surrounding environments. Using adverse air pressure items can help maintain containment by filtering out potential asbestos fibers from the air.

Disposal of asbestos waste is topic to specific regulations. It generally needs to be bagged in double-walled, labeled containers and disposed of at designated amenities geared up to deal with hazardous materials. Following proper disposal guidelines reduces the danger of asbestos contaminating landfills or surrounding areas. It is a elementary a part of minimizing public exposure to this hazardous material.


Post-removal inspections and air high quality testing are essential steps that should not be missed. After the asbestos has been eliminated, it’s important to ensure that no fibers remain within the air or on surfaces. Monitoring air quality helps verify the success of the removal course of and protects staff and the common public from residual dangers.

Asbestos roof removal is regulated by both federal and state guidelines. The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) set strict requirements for handling asbestos. Compliance includes proper notification, worker security measures, and proper disposal strategies to make sure minimal exposure to the hazardous material.


How do I know if my roof accommodates asbestos?


To determine in case your roof incorporates asbestos, an expert inspection is recommended. A certified asbestos inspector can collect samples and ship them for laboratory evaluation to confirm the presence of asbestos.

What steps ought to I take earlier than eradicating an asbestos roof?


Before eradicating an asbestos roof, it is important to hire a licensed asbestos abatement contractor. Obtain needed permits and notify local health and security authorities. Ensure that the site is well-marked and that untrained personnel are stored away through the removal process to minimize publicity risks.

Are there specific disposal guidelines for asbestos roofing materials?


Yes, there are strict disposal guidelines for asbestos roofing materials. As per EPA regulations, materials have to be disposed of at designated hazardous waste amenities. They must be sealed in leak-tight containers and labeled appropriately to prevent unintentional publicity.

What fines or penalties may result from improper asbestos roof removal?


Improper removal of asbestos can result in vital fines and penalties from regulatory bodies like the EPA and OSHA. Penalties can vary based mostly on the severity of the violation but could embrace hefty fines, mandatory cleanup prices, and legal action towards people or firms accountable.

Is it authorized to remove asbestos roofing myself?


No, it's generally unlawful for untrained people to remove asbestos roofing because of the vital health dangers concerned. Only licensed professionals who adhere to safety protocols and regulations ought to conduct such work to guard public health and security.

What should I do if I suspect asbestos publicity throughout roof removal?


If you think asbestos publicity, stop the removal process immediately and evacuate the world. Seek medical recommendation and report the incident to local authorities and health division for additional evaluation and assistance concerning potential health effects.
